Review of the XENON dark matter detector

Started Mar. 23, 2023

Abstract or project description

This project aims to examine the methodology behind the XENON dark matter detector, which utilizes liquid Xenon as a medium to detect signals generated from collisions between dark matter and known particles. It discusses the production of photons and energy from the dark matter-particle collisions and the infrastructure of the XENON detector—including photomultiplier tubes and the time-projection chamber—that aids in converting these signals into plausible explanations for the presence of dark matter. Major caveats to the detection of dark matter signals range from cosmic rays to radioactive material and excess water, and this paper introduces solutions to minimize the impact of background "noise" that may hinder the identification of proper dark matter signals.
